Advanced Driver Monitoring Systems: Safety That Watches Out for You
A substantial focus in automotive innovation is lowering human mistake, and 2025 will present a lot more refined vehicle driver surveillance systems. These configurations use indoor cams and sensors to maintain track of the chauffeur's actions, eye motion, head position, and also stress degrees based on face stress or heart rate.
If the system detects sleepiness, it can issue a prompt alert. If distraction is kept in mind, it can gently assist focus back to the road. These attributes are especially useful in heavy traffic or during late-night driving. With numerous people handling tight routines, this sort of built-in support can be a literal lifesaver. Next-Gen Augmented Reality Dashboards: Information, Clearly Displayed
Heads-up display screens have actually been around for some time, but in 2025, they're developing into something much more vibrant. Enhanced Reality (AR) control panels are starting to replace conventional screens with immersive overlays that forecast info straight onto the windshield. That indicates navigation hints, danger warnings, and speed limitations all show up in your line of sight without taking your eyes off the road.
This enhancement makes driving safer and more intuitive. You'll obtain real-time updates that incorporate efficiently with the world in front of you. It's not just about making driving easier-- it's concerning transforming the entire windscreen right into a command center that helps you concentrate and react rapidly. Vehicle-to-Everything (V2X) Communication: Talking to the World Around You
While self-governing cars still have some distance to go, the systems that sustain them are proceeding quickly. One of the most awaited adjustments being available in 2025 is V2X communication. This modern technology permits your cars and truck to exchange information with other lorries, traffic control, road sensors, and also infrastructure systems like bridges or construction areas.
What does that mean for chauffeurs? A smoother, safer trip. Your vehicle can alert you if an additional car is coming close to as well quickly from a dead spot, if there's a collision up in advance, or if a red light will change. It's like your cars and truck has eyes and ears beyond what you can see. This details isn't just beneficial-- it could help in reducing website traffic mishaps, boost flow, and even reduced insurance expenses over time.
When these systems end up being extensively implemented, commuting can become less difficult and extra efficient. It's an advancement that places connection to work in meaningful, daily means.
